Isosceles triangle, perimeter if the perimeter of isosceles triangle abc is 20 and the length of side ac is 8, what is one possi
Hoochie [10]

The perimeter = 20 and AC = 8

Now as it is not mentioned which sides are equal of the isosceles triangle ABC,

We have two possible situations.

1)

If AC is the base

In that case AB = BC

Now AC = 8, AB = x , BC = x

So x + x + 8 = 20

2x + 8 = 20

2x = 12

x = 6

AB = BC = 6

2)

IF AC is not the base,

Then

AC = BC or AC = AB

So BC = 8 or AB = 8

If AB = AC = 8

Then

BC + 8 + 8 = 20

BC = 4

So there are two possible lengths of BC

Either it is BC = 8 or BC = 6 or BC = 4
